Pre-IPO Advisory Services: Bridging Private and Public Markets
Pre-IPO advisory services represent a specialized strategic function designed to guide private enterprises through the complex transition to becoming a publicly-traded entity. For high-growth startups, blockchain unicorns, and established firms planning to list on major global exchanges like the NASDAQ or NYSE, these services provide the roadmap for navigating regulatory scrutiny, financial restructuring, and investor relations. As the boundary between traditional finance (TradFi) and digital assets blurs, the scope of these services has expanded to include specialized guidance for crypto-native firms seeking public status.
The Strategic Importance of Pre-IPO Advisory Services
The journey to an Initial Public Offering (IPO) is often a multi-year process that requires a fundamental transformation of a company's DNA. Pre-IPO advisory services act as the bridge between private operational flexibility and the rigorous transparency required by public markets. According to data from various consultancy reports in 2023, companies that engage in comprehensive pre-listing preparation 18 to 24 months in advance tend to achieve more favorable valuations and smoother registration processes with the SEC or equivalent regional regulators.

Core Pillars of Pre-IPO Readiness
1. Financial Reporting and Audit Compliance
The transition from private accounting standards to PCAOB (Public Company Accounting Oversight Board) standards is a significant hurdle. Advisory services focus on converting financial statements to US GAAP or IFRS and ensuring that internal audit functions can withstand the scrutiny of institutional investors. For crypto-centric firms, this includes the complex task of auditing on-chain assets and reconciling them with off-chain liabilities.
2. Corporate Governance and Internal Controls
Public companies must establish a formal Board of Directors with independent members, audit committees, and compensation committees. Implementation of Sarbanes-Oxley (SOX) compliance frameworks is essential to prevent financial fraud and ensure the integrity of financial disclosures. This structural maturity is what distinguishes a "startup" from a "publicly-ready" organization.
3. Tax Structuring and Valuation
Advisors assist in 409A valuations and the restructuring of capital tables to optimize tax footprints for both the company and its shareholders post-listing. This involves detailed analysis of equity compensation plans and the potential impact of public market volatility on long-term tax liabilities.
The Advisory Process: Phases of Execution
Executing a successful public listing is typically divided into three distinct phases, each requiring different levels of specialized consulting.
| Phase 1: Diagnostic | Gap analysis, historical audit review, assessment of management team. | 18-24 Months Pre-IPO |
| Phase 2: Remediation | Upgrading IT systems, formalizing accounting policies, Board formation. | 6-12 Months Pre-IPO |
| Phase 3: Execution | Drafting S-1/F-1 filings, roadshow preparation, SEC comment response. | 0-6 Months Pre-IPO |
The data in the table above illustrates that the most successful listings are those that treat the "Diagnostic" phase as a long-term strategic investment. By identifying deficiencies early—whether in financial reporting or operational scalability—firms can avoid the costly delays associated with SEC inquiries or failed roadshows.
Emerging Trends: Crypto and Web3 Public Readiness
As digital assets become a mainstream asset class, pre-IPO advisory services are increasingly focusing on "Web3 readiness." This involves unique challenges such as verifying the ownership of private keys, assessing the legal status of utility tokens, and integrating blockchain data into traditional financial reports. Strategic Positioning and the "Equity Story"
Beyond the technical requirements, advisors help management teams craft a compelling "Equity Story." This is the narrative presented to institutional investors during the roadshow, focusing on market opportunity, competitive advantages, and future growth drivers. In the digital economy, this narrative often includes the integration of traditional financial services with decentralized technology. Sustainable Growth Beyond the Listing
The completion of an IPO is only the beginning. Post-IPO sustainability involves ongoing SEC filings (10-K, 10-Q), quarterly earnings calls, and maintaining the trust of the investor base. Companies must continue to demonstrate the same level of transparency and risk management that they promised during the advisory phase.
